Running low on battery while you're away? Handheld phone powering solutions are shifting towards increasingly common. These often involve rental points, which are dedicated areas where you can rent a charged power bank for a short period. Alternatively, some businesses are setting up self-service kiosks – essentially automated vending machines – offering similar services, allowing you to quickly get the energy you need. The cost typically involves a small fee, and they’re popping up in popular areas like airports, rail stations, and tourist destinations providing a convenient solution to low battery anxieties.

Fueling on the Go: Reviewing Movable Battery Pack Choices

Never be caught with a empty power source! Current mobile gadgets demand regular charging, and fortunately, there’s a growing market of portable power solutions. From slim plus-portable lipstick-sized chargers to hefty batteries capable of fully powering your phone many times, you can find an option to suit every need also price range. Consider factors like capacity (Amp hours), size, weight, and power delivery speed when selecting the right device for your lifestyle.
